About the Program

The Midnight Kitchen Collective runs a free prepared meal program. Meals are vegan and nut-free, and each meal will include a nutritious main course, a side and a dessert.

Our lunch program is available to McGill undergraduate and graduate students, as well as community members. This program is targeted to low-income students, and/or students with disabilities, chronic illness, mental health conditions, or other impairments, who self-identify as benefiting from access to food through Midnight Kitchen.

Location: SSMU Ballroom (University Centre, 3rd Floor), 3480 McTavish Street

Schedule: Service is on Wednesdays or Thursdays at 1pm but please check our calendar for exact dates.

Masking: For Covid safety reasons, we encourage our service users to wear a mask while picking up their food, circulating in the space and take their meal to go if they are able. There are also masks available at the building entrance and we will leave some by the ballroom entrance.

Accessibility info

The pickup location will now be inside of the University Center, located at 3480 rue McTavish, at the Downtown Campus. The building is accessible via a ramp or stairs, and contains an elevator. There are gender-neutral as well as wheelchair-accessible bathrooms in the building.

If you have any accessibility concerns about entering the building, because of Covid-19 risk factors or otherwise, PLEASE email us and we will come up with a solution. We will try our best to accommodate within our capacity, and want to emphasize that we put staff and participants' health first.
